I have... ahhh... a lot of these. It's a little embarrassing, but I can't stop buying them. I found my first haul in the after-Christmas pillage of
my local Big Lots, they were 4-packs discounted to about $2. I ended up with about 30. Then later my local United Dollar (sort of an off-brand dollar store,
as opposed to the big chain Dollar Tree) had two-packs for $1. Every man has a price I guess, and my price for plastic dinosaurs is about fifty-cents. I
can't say no to a deal like that.
Actually, I had decided that 30 was more than plenty, but then I came up with an idea for a skeletal hydra, I thought I could take a few necks from the brontosauruses and the body of triceratops and kit-bash something serviceable, so I had to go back and clear out their brontos. I was done then, but then I thought about those goofy looking pterodons, not great minis but I could cut the wings off to make skeletal half-dragons and any other winged, skeletal undead I might need. Apparently no one else in my area was aware of the awesome potential of these toys, because ended up clearing the place out at a rate of about $5 a week. I have two shopping bags of unopened packs in my work room, waiting to be turned into skeletal hydras and skeletal half-dragon hydras. (I've also thought about doing a longboat with a skeletal figurehead.) I've pretty much stopped going into my local United Dollar because I know if they've restocked I'll only end up clearing them out all over again. |
